queen as pawn

Queen as Pawn is a statement about power; stripped, hidden, unacknowledged or unrecognized, and the experience of moving through systems that fail to recognize one’s worth and value, and the quiet resilience necessary to survive them.

Original Work (SOLD): oil on 24x36 custom gallery wrap canvas

hush shirley

Combining a stark, skeletal self-portrait with a hauntingly repetitive poem, Hush Shirley investigates the heavy architecture of keeping secrets. The piece uncovers the literal and emotional spine of an unspoken burden, creating a powerful dialogue between what the flesh hides and what the spirit remembers.
